Autovit Cars Search Scraper avatar
Autovit Cars Search Scraper

Pricing

$15.00/month + usage

Go to Apify Store
Autovit Cars Search Scraper

Autovit Cars Search Scraper

Automate vehicle listing extraction from Autovit.ro, Romania's leading automotive marketplace. Extract cars, motorcycles, parts, and commercial vehicles with complete pricing, specifications, seller details, and photos for market analysis and inventory research.

Pricing

$15.00/month + usage

Rating

0.0

(0)

Developer

ecomscrape

ecomscrape

Maintained by Community

Actor stats

0

Bookmarked

2

Total users

1

Monthly active users

3 days ago

Last modified

Share

Contact

If you encounter any issues or need to exchange information, please feel free to contact us through the following link: My profile

Autovit.ro Cars Scraper: Extract Romanian Auto Market Data for Dealers & Buyers

Introduction

Autovit.ro stands as Romania's premier online automotive marketplace, connecting thousands of car dealers, private sellers, and buyers across the country. As part of the OLX Group automotive vertical, Autovit hosts extensive listings spanning passenger cars, motorcycles, commercial vehicles, agricultural machinery, and auto parts, making it an essential platform for anyone involved in Romania's automotive market.

For automotive dealers, market researchers, price comparison services, and buyers seeking comprehensive market intelligence, Autovit.ro contains valuable data that can inform pricing strategies, inventory decisions, and market trends. However, manually collecting vehicle listings across different categories, locations, and price ranges is impractical when analyzing thousands of listings or tracking market dynamics over time.

The Autovit.ro Cars Scraper automates this data extraction process, enabling systematic collection of vehicle listings with complete specifications, pricing, seller information, and location data. Whether you're a dealer monitoring competitor inventory, a researcher analyzing Romanian automotive market trends, or building a price comparison platform, this scraper provides the structured data extraction needed for informed decision-making.

Scraper Overview

The Autovit.ro Cars Scraper is a specialized automotive data extraction tool designed to systematically collect vehicle listings from Romania's largest auto marketplace. This scraper employs advanced web automation to navigate search results and extract detailed vehicle profiles across multiple categories including passenger cars, motorcycles, commercial vehicles, construction equipment, agricultural machinery, and auto parts.

Key advantages include configurable retry mechanisms for network reliability, flexible sorting options by price, mileage, power, and date, and comprehensive pagination controls for large-scale data collection. The tool is particularly valuable for automotive dealers tracking inventory and pricing, market analysts studying Romanian auto trends, price comparison platforms aggregating listings, and buyers conducting thorough market research before purchase decisions.

The scraper handles various search parameters including vehicle type filtering, condition specification (new/used), keyword searches, and multiple sorting criteria. It extracts rich listing data including verified seller information, detailed vehicle parameters, pricing with evaluation indicators, location data, and visual assets, providing complete market intelligence for automotive business operations.

Input and Output Details

Example url 1: https://www.autovit.ro/autoturisme?search%5Border%5D=filter_float_engine_power%3Aasc

Example url 2: https://www.autovit.ro/autoturisme/q-suv?search%5Border%5D=filter_float_engine_power%3Aasc&page=2

Example url 3: https://www.autovit.ro/piese/autoturism/second

Example Screenshot of automotive list by query page:

Input Format

The scraper accepts JSON configuration controlling data extraction from Autovit.ro listings:

Scrape with URLs:

{
"proxy": {
"useApifyProxy": false
},
"ignore_url_failures": true,
"max_retries_per_url": 2,
"max_items_per_url": 20,
"urls": [
"https://www.autovit.ro/autoturisme?search%5Border%5D=filter_float_engine_power%3Aasc",
"https://www.autovit.ro/autoturisme/q-suv?search%5Border%5D=created_at%3Adesc",
"https://www.autovit.ro/motociclete/bucuresti"
]
}

The urls parameter: Add URLs of vehicle search result pages from Autovit.ro. Paste URLs individually or use bulk edit for prepared lists. Ideal for extracting specific pre-filtered searches.

The ignore_url_failures parameter: When true, scraper continues even if some URLs fail after maximum retries, preventing one problematic URL from stopping the entire job.

When providing URLs, all search filter options are disabled—only specified URLs are scraped.

Scrape with Search Filters:

{
"keyword": "BMW X5",
"vehical_type": "autoturisme",
"vehical_state": "second",
"sort_by": "filter_float_price:asc",
"page": 1,
"max_items_per_url": 50,
"max_retries_per_url": 2,
"proxy": {
"useApifyProxy": true,
"apifyProxyGroups": ["RESIDENTIAL"],
"apifyProxyCountry": "RO"
}
}

The keyword parameter: Search term for vehicles (e.g., "BMW X5", "Mercedes", "Toyota", "diesel", "4x4"). Searches across make, model, and listing descriptions.

The vehical_type parameter: Select vehicle category:

  • "autoturisme" - Passenger cars
  • "piese" - Parts
  • "piese/autoturism" - Car parts specifically
  • "utilaje-constructii" - Construction equipment
  • "utilaje-agricole" - Agricultural machinery
  • "autoutilitare" - Commercial/utility vehicles
  • "motociclete" - Motorcycles
  • "remorci" - Trailers

The vehical_state parameter: Filter by condition:

  • "" - All conditions
  • "second" - Used vehicles
  • "nou" - New vehicles

The sort_by parameter: Order results by:

  • "" - Recommended (default)
  • "created_at:desc" - Newest listings first
  • "created_at_first:asc" - Oldest listings first
  • "filter_float_price:desc" - Highest price first
  • "filter_float_price:asc" - Lowest price first
  • "filter_float_mileage:desc" - Highest mileage first
  • "filter_float_mileage:asc" - Lowest mileage first
  • "filter_float_engine_power:desc" - Most powerful first
  • "filter_float_engine_power:asc" - Least powerful first

The page parameter: Starting page number for pagination control.

When using search filters, leave the urls field empty.

General Options:

The max_items_per_url parameter: Limit items extracted per URL or search. Default 20, adjust based on research scope.

The max_retries_per_url parameter: Retry attempts for failed requests. Default 2 balances thoroughness with efficiency.

The proxy parameter: Proxy configuration for avoiding detection. Romanian proxies recommended for optimal Autovit.ro access.

Output Format

The scraper returns structured vehicle listing data:

  • ID: Unique listing identifier in Autovit's system. Essential for tracking specific vehicles, avoiding duplicates, and linking to source listings.

  • Title: Vehicle listing headline including make, model, and key features. Primary identifier for quick vehicle recognition and database indexing.

  • Created At: Listing publication timestamp. Critical for tracking market inventory freshness, analyzing listing age, and identifying new market entries.

  • Short Description: Brief vehicle summary or highlights. Provides quick overview of key selling points and special features for initial screening.

  • URL: Direct link to full listing page. Enables access to complete details, additional photos, and seller contact for verified leads.

  • Badges: Special indicators like "Featured," "Premium," or verification badges. Identifies promoted listings, dealer quality signals, and trustworthiness indicators.

  • Seller UUID: Unique seller identifier. Allows tracking inventory from specific dealers, analyzing seller patterns, and building dealer databases.

  • Brand Program: Manufacturer certification or dealer program affiliation. Indicates authorized dealers, certified pre-owned programs, and warranty coverage.

  • Category: Vehicle classification (car, motorcycle, truck, etc.). Enables filtering and segmentation by vehicle type for targeted analysis.

  • Thumbnail: Primary listing image URL. Visual identification for listings, enriching databases, and creating visual catalogs.

  • Parameters: Structured vehicle specifications including year, mileage, fuel type, transmission, engine power, body type. Core technical data for price analysis, comparison tools, and detailed filtering.

  • Location: Geographic listing location (city, region). Essential for local market analysis, logistics planning, and regional pricing studies.

  • Seller Link: Profile URL for seller/dealer. Access to complete dealer inventory, reputation information, and contact details.

  • Price: Listed price in Romanian Lei (RON). Primary metric for pricing analysis, market valuation, and competitive positioning.

  • Dealer 4th Package: Premium dealer subscription indicator. Identifies professional high-volume dealers versus occasional sellers.

  • Value Added Services: Additional services offered (warranty, financing, delivery). Indicates dealer service level and value proposition beyond vehicle price.

  • Price Evaluation: Platform's price assessment (good deal, fair price, above market). Autovit's algorithmic pricing guidance for market comparison.

  • Cepik Verified: Polish vehicle history verification status (applicable for imported cars). Indicates verified vehicle history and import documentation for cross-border vehicles.

Each field supports automotive market intelligence, competitive pricing analysis, inventory management, and buyer research workflows.

Example Output:

[
{
"id": "7059482538",
"title": "BMW Seria 3 330e iPerformance Advantage",
"created_at": "2026-01-12T08:18:16Z",
"short_description": "",
"url": "https://www.autovit.ro/autoturisme/anunt/bmw-seria-3-ver-330e-iperformance-advantage-ID7HKRTA.html",
"badges": [],
"seller_uuid": null,
"brand_program": null,
"category": {
"__typename": "Category",
"id": "29"
},
"thumbnail": {
"__typename": "Image",
"x1": "https://ireland.apollo.olxcdn.com/v1/files/hei7rttz2zno-AUTOVITRO/image;s=320x240",
"x2": "https://ireland.apollo.olxcdn.com/v1/files/hei7rttz2zno-AUTOVITRO/image;s=640x480"
},
"parameters": [
{
"__typename": "AdvertParameter",
"key": "make",
"display_value": "BMW",
"label": "make",
"value": "bmw"
},
{
"__typename": "AdvertParameter",
"key": "fuel_type",
"display_value": "Hibrid Plug-In",
"label": "fuel_type",
"value": "plugin-hybrid"
},
{
"__typename": "AdvertParameter",
"key": "mileage",
"display_value": "168000 km",
"label": "mileage",
"value": "168000"
},
{
"__typename": "AdvertParameter",
"key": "engine_capacity",
"display_value": "1998 cm3",
"label": "engine_capacity",
"value": "1998"
},
{
"__typename": "AdvertParameter",
"key": "engine_power",
"display_value": "251 CP",
"label": "engine_power",
"value": "251"
},
{
"__typename": "AdvertParameter",
"key": "model",
"display_value": "Seria 3",
"label": "model",
"value": "seria-3"
},
{
"__typename": "AdvertParameter",
"key": "version",
"display_value": "330e iPerformance Advantage",
"label": "version",
"value": "ver-330e-iperformance-advantage"
},
{
"__typename": "AdvertParameter",
"key": "year",
"display_value": "2018",
"label": "year",
"value": "2018"
}
],
"location": {
"__typename": "Location",
"city": {
"__typename": "AdministrativeLevel",
"name": "Cluj-Napoca"
},
"region": {
"__typename": "AdministrativeLevel",
"name": "Cluj"
}
},
"seller_link": {
"__typename": "AdvertSellerLink",
"id": "4494755",
"name": "DLN AUTO",
"website_url": "https://dlnauto.autovit.ro",
"is_credit_intermediary": false,
"logo": {
"__typename": "Image",
"x1": "https://ireland.apollo.olxcdn.com/v1/files/eyJmbiI6ImllY291aGFzMmR3LUFVVE9WSVRSTyJ9.Qkrmshfo4yQ1ROA4Sok5pbQGN8h28kr1hpILtdpmay4/image;s=140x24"
}
},
"price": {
"__typename": "Price",
"badges": [],
"gross_price": null,
"net_price": null,
"amount": {
"__typename": "Money",
"units": 12999,
"nanos": 0,
"value": "12999",
"currency_code": "EUR"
}
},
"dealer4th_package": {
"__typename": "AdvertDealer4thPackage",
"services": [],
"package": {
"__typename": "SellerPackage",
"id": "44",
"name": "Platinum Plus"
},
"photos": {
"__typename": "PhotosCollection",
"total_count": 5,
"nodes": [
{
"__typename": "Image",
"url": "https://ireland.apollo.olxcdn.com/v1/files/hei7rttz2zno-AUTOVITRO/image;s=644x461"
},
{
"__typename": "Image",
"url": "https://ireland.apollo.olxcdn.com/v1/files/s3utio7wefi43-AUTOVITRO/image;s=644x461"
},
{
"__typename": "Image",
"url": "https://ireland.apollo.olxcdn.com/v1/files/mtlnmx9f1y873-AUTOVITRO/image;s=644x461"
},
{
"__typename": "Image",
"url": "https://ireland.apollo.olxcdn.com/v1/files/04whj41zlzzr2-AUTOVITRO/image;s=644x461"
},
{
"__typename": "Image",
"url": "https://ireland.apollo.olxcdn.com/v1/files/9vxkt370ukiz-AUTOVITRO/image;s=644x461"
}
]
}
},
"value_added_services": [
{
"__typename": "AdValueAddedService",
"name": "topads",
"validity": "2026-02-11T08:15:17Z",
"applied_at": null
},
{
"__typename": "AdValueAddedService",
"name": "export_olx",
"validity": "2026-02-11T08:15:16Z",
"applied_at": null
}
],
"price_evaluation": {
"__typename": "PriceEvaluation",
"indicator": "NONE"
},
"cepik_verified": false,
"from_url": "https://www.autovit.ro/autoturisme/bmw"
}
]

Usage Guide

Option 1: Scraping with URLs

Navigate to Autovit.ro and construct your desired search using filters for make, model, price range, year, location, and other criteria. Copy the resulting URL into the urls array. This method is ideal when you have specific searches already configured on the platform.

Best practices:

  • Test individual URLs before batch processing to verify they return expected results
  • Use ignore_url_failures to prevent single URL issues from stopping large jobs
  • Monitor Romanian automotive market hours—listings update throughout the day
  • Keep URL lists organized by category (cars, motorcycles, parts) for structured data collection

Troubleshooting:

  • If URLs fail, verify they're from current search results (old URLs may expire)
  • Check proxy settings if encountering access blocks
  • Ensure URL encoding is preserved when copying (especially for special characters)

Option 2: Scraping with Search Filters

Setting Up Vehicle Search Criteria

Step 1: Select Vehicle Type

Choose the appropriate vehical_type:

  • autoturisme: For passenger cars—sedans, hatchbacks, SUVs, coupes
  • motociclete: For motorcycles and scooters
  • autoutilitare: For vans, trucks, and commercial vehicles
  • piese: For auto parts and accessories
  • utilaje-constructii: For construction machinery
  • utilaje-agricole: For tractors and agricultural equipment
  • remorci: For trailers

Step 2: Define Search Keywords

Use keyword for specific searches:

  • Brand/model: "BMW X5", "Volkswagen Golf", "Audi A4"
  • Features: "4x4", "diesel", "automatic", "panoramic"
  • General: "SUV", "sedan", "hatchback"

Step 3: Filter by Condition

Set vehical_state:

  • "nou": New vehicles from dealers
  • "second": Used vehicles (majority of marketplace)
  • "": All conditions

Step 4: Configure Sorting

Use sort_by to prioritize results:

  • Price analysis: Sort by price (ascending/descending) to identify market ranges
  • Fresh listings: Sort by creation date (descending) for newest inventory
  • Mileage research: Sort by mileage for low/high mileage analysis
  • Performance search: Sort by engine power for performance comparisons

Step 5: Set Pagination

  • Start from page: 1 for complete coverage
  • Adjust max_items_per_url based on research depth (20-100 typical)
  • Use pagination to segment large result sets across multiple runs

Best Practices for Filter-Based Scraping

Keyword Strategy:

  • Use Romanian terminology when relevant ("autoturism" not "car")
  • Search specific models for targeted analysis
  • Use feature keywords for cross-brand comparisons

Market Segmentation:

  • Run separate searches for new vs. used to compare pricing dynamics
  • Segment by vehicle type for category-specific analysis
  • Filter by location for regional market studies

Sorting for Analysis:

  • Price sorting reveals market price distribution and outliers
  • Date sorting identifies inventory turnover rates
  • Mileage sorting helps establish average usage patterns

Systematic Coverage:

  1. Define target brands/models based on research objectives
  2. Run searches for each segment (new/used, different locations)
  3. Use consistent sorting across searches for comparable data
  4. Track extraction dates for time-series analysis

Data Validation

Verify extracted data:

  • Price values are in correct currency (RON or EUR)
  • Parameters contain expected fields (year, mileage, fuel type)
  • Location data matches Romanian geography
  • Seller information is complete for dealer listings
  • Timestamps are recent and accurate

Common Issues

Search Returns No Results:

  • Verify keyword spelling (Romanian vs. English terms)
  • Check vehicle type matches search criteria
  • Try broader keywords before narrowing
  • Confirm vehicle state filter isn't too restrictive

Incomplete Parameters:

  • Some private listings may lack detailed specifications
  • Older listings may have limited structured data
  • Consider filtering for dealer listings for more complete data

Price Evaluation Missing:

  • Not all listings have platform price assessments
  • Newer listings may lack evaluation until market data accumulates
  • Premium/dealer listings more likely to have evaluations

Advanced Techniques

Competitive Pricing Analysis:

  • Scrape competitor dealer inventories using seller_link filtering
  • Compare pricing across similar vehicles (same make/model/year/mileage)
  • Track price changes over time by re-scraping same searches

Market Trend Monitoring:

  • Schedule regular scrapes (daily/weekly) to track inventory changes
  • Monitor new listing rates by sorting by creation date
  • Analyze average pricing trends across vehicle segments

Dealer Intelligence:

  • Extract all listings from specific dealers using seller UUID
  • Compare dealer pricing strategies and inventory mix
  • Identify authorized brand dealers through Brand Program field

Geographic Analysis:

  • Run location-specific searches for regional pricing differences
  • Compare urban vs. rural market dynamics
  • Identify regional vehicle preferences and availability

Benefits and Applications

Primary Applications:

Automotive Dealer Intelligence: Track competitor inventory, pricing strategies, and market positioning. Monitor which vehicles competitors stock, how they price relative to market, and identify inventory gaps.

Market Research & Analysis: Analyze Romanian automotive market trends including popular models, average pricing by segment, inventory turnover rates, and regional market differences.

Price Comparison Services: Build comprehensive vehicle pricing databases enabling consumers to compare prices across dealers, identify good deals, and make informed purchase decisions.

Inventory Planning: Understand market demand by tracking which vehicles sell quickly, identify underserved segments, and optimize dealer inventory mix based on market data.

Buyer Market Research: Conduct thorough pre-purchase research by comparing similar vehicles across multiple dealers, tracking price trends over time, and identifying the best value propositions.

Advantages:

  • Comprehensive Romanian automotive market coverage from leading platform
  • Rich structured data including specifications, pricing, and seller information
  • Verification indicators (badges, dealer programs, CEPIK) for quality assessment
  • Location data enabling geographic market analysis
  • Timestamp information for tracking market dynamics over time

Data integrates with dealership management systems, pricing tools, CRM platforms, and market analysis software for immediate business application.

Conclusion

The Autovit.ro Cars Scraper transforms manual vehicle listing research into automated market intelligence for Romania's automotive sector. By providing structured access to the country's largest automotive marketplace, it enables dealers, researchers, and buyers to make data-driven decisions about pricing, inventory, and purchasing.

Whether monitoring competitor dealer strategies, analyzing market pricing trends, building price comparison platforms, or conducting pre-purchase research, this scraper delivers the systematic data extraction needed for Romanian automotive market intelligence.

Your feedback

We are always working to improve Actors' performance. So, if you have any technical feedback about autovit.ro Property Search Scraper or simply found a bug, please create an issue on the Actor's Issues tab in Apify Console.